مارگزیده از ریسمان سیاه و سفید می‌ترسد

used to suggest that past experiences can influence a person's future behavior and attitudes, and that negative experiences can lead to unnecessary fear or caution
ProverbProverb
example
مثال‌ها
He had a bad experience with a difficult boss at his previous job, and now he's afraid to speak up or assert himself at work - illustrating how the man who has once been bitten by a snake fears every piece of rope.
